2016-11-29 95 views
0

我有一個可編輯的圖像Web部件,我試圖上傳一個圖像作爲附件。事件日誌告訴我:Kentico上傳附件許可

消息:您無權執行此操作。

異常類型:System.Exception的 堆棧跟蹤: 在MultiFileUploader.ContentUploader.CheckAttachmentUploadPermissions(UploaderHelper 參數) 在MultiFileUploader.ContentUploader.ProcessRequest(HttpContext的背景下)

這是在我的本地開發發生機器,而我即將在我擁有的開發虛擬機上進行測試。另外,我正在使用默認的管理員帳戶。

而且,我可以在「可編輯文本」Web部件中上載附件。

回答

1

有可能導致這幾件事情:

  • 用戶運行的網站/應用程序池沒有權限讀/寫的目錄服務器上
  • IIS未正確配置授權
  • Kentico配置不正確(基於錯誤,它是最有可能不是這個)
+0

我以爲附件被存儲在數據庫中? IIS_IUSER作爲CMS文件夾的完全控制。 奇怪的是,我可以在「編輯文本」Web部件中上傳附件。 –

+0

這是一個桌面iis的問題。 dev vm很好。 –

+1

即使將附件和文件存儲在數據庫中,該文件仍會暫時上傳到服務器,然後在將其存儲在數據庫中後將其刪除。 –